Geneva/Dagestan - The humanitarian organisation Médecins Sans Frontieres (MSF) confirms that Arjan Erkel, a Dutch national working as head of Mission for MSF since February 2002 in Makhachkala, in the Russian Republic of Dagestan, was abducted yesterday evening (August 12). The kidnapping occurred in Makhachkala at around 10.00pm.

On his way home, the MSF car was intercepted by a local vehicle with three men on board - two of them armed - and Arjan was abducted and pushed into another car. MSF is extremely concerned about this incident and demands the immediate safe release of Arjan.
